Intel's Profit and Revenue Exceed Estimates, Shares Rise 10%

Intel's quarterly profit and revenue exceeded estimates, driving its shares up by 10%. The company expects $15.8 billion to $16.8 billion in third-quarter revenue, with adjusted profit of 38 cents per share. This growth is fueled by the AI boom and increasing demand for its central processing units.

Intel forecasts a profit of $4.8 billion in the current quarter and $18.5 billion for the full year. The company plans to raise its capital expenditure forecast for this year from $18 billion to $20 billion, driven by growing demand for its CPUs in the AI data center market.

Rewarding Better Thinking for LLM Preference Alignment

Researchers propose a new approach to optimize language models toward human preferences. The approach, called Thinking Checklist Reward (TCR), uses a process-oriented reward to evaluate the generated reasoning trace.

Etched Raises $300 Million

Etched has raised $300 million in new financing at a $10.3 billion valuation to scale AI inference hardware. The financing was led by Sequoia Capital.
